July 22nd, 2008

Do to the constant destruction of tee signs #2 and #9 we used to some new mounting methods. The laminated signs are now sandwiched between 1/2″ plywood and 1/4″ plexiglas and secured to the trees with 4″ lag bolts. We have more plexigas on order to make frames for the signs.

Work Update.

June 28th, 2008

The final 4 baskets went in today and all 9 holes are now playable. All the holes now have new tee signs with all of our sponsors and all tees are marked with orange painted 4×4’s. At the entrance to the course is a brief rules sign explaining how the game is to be played.
